Reply to the Giovanni Porcari's message, wrote on 11/02/2021 at 14:11:
Il giorno 4 dic 2020, alle ore 11:08, Gabriele Battaglia
ha scritto:
Se cerco la chiave conoscendo il valore, esiste una funzione da
applicare sul dizionario che me la fornisca direttamente, invece di
dover iterare con
> Il giorno 4 dic 2020, alle ore 11:08, Gabriele Battaglia
> ha scritto:
>
> Se cerco la chiave conoscendo il valore, esiste una funzione da applicare sul
> dizionario che me la fornisca direttamente, invece di dover iterare con un
> for su tutti i valori?
Potresti usare questo :
https://p
Ciao.
Se cerco la chiave conoscendo il valore, esiste una funzione da
applicare sul dizionario che me la fornisca direttamente, invece di
dover iterare con un for su tutti i valori?
Grazie.
G
--
Gabriele Battaglia, IZ4APU (Libero)
Sent from TB on Windows 10, Genus Bononiae's computer.
scusa items() e non iteritems() che é python2 ... sorry ma sono in una fare
di migrazione progetto da py2 a py3 e sto impazzendo :/
On Fri, Dec 4, 2020 at 11:25 AM Ernesto Arbitrio
wrote:
> nel caso di valori univoci puoi invertire il dizionario:
>
> mydict2 = dict(map(reversed, mydict.items()))
nel caso di valori univoci puoi invertire il dizionario:
mydict2 = dict(map(reversed, mydict.items()))
e quindi
mydict2[val]
altrimenti non hai alternative secondo me ... devi iterare (o usare
librerie esterne tipo Pandas)
quindi scriverti qualcosa che usi una list comprehension
[k for k, v in
On Fri, 4 Dec 2020 at 10:08, Gabriele Battaglia wrote:
> Ciao.
>
Ciao Gabriele
> Se cerco la chiave conoscendo il valore, esiste una funzione da
> applicare sul dizionario che me la fornisca direttamente, invece di
> dover iterare con un for su tutti i valori?
>
Non esiste questa funzione che
Domanda ... ma i valori sono unici ?? nel senso non hai situazioni tipo
{"a":1, "b":1}??
On Fri, Dec 4, 2020 at 11:08 AM Gabriele Battaglia wrote:
> Ciao.
> Se cerco la chiave conoscendo il valore, esiste una funzione da
> applicare sul dizionario che me la fornisca direttamente, invece di
> dov